Sorry I could not join the party earlier. I started testing TeXLive 2012
i386 on current. The diff 

http://junkpile.org/tl.diff.2

Stuart posted works great. TeXLive builds and runs fine. I tested many
complex documents. Some highlights of my early testing:

1. Semantic checkers chktex and lacheck work as expected
2. PSTrics (heavy user here) works as expected. My usual workflow
tex->dvi->ps->pdf works without a glitch.
3. bibtex, natbib works great have not checked biblatex will check. 
4. RevTeX4.1  class which I used to install manually works as expected.
5. ModernCV, modern letter, exams class works as expected.
6. I tested flyers, posters, badges, powerdot all sorts of very
complicated documents (floats, hyperref, index anything you can think
of).
7. Have not checked latexmk (I usually use home brewed Makefiles) on my
todo list.
8. I have not tested MetaPost on my todo list (I do not use it). I am
also planning to play with Metafont.
9. Asymptote not tested.
10. pdfjam tested.
11. tex4ht and htlatex tested.
12. LuaTeX not tested, ConTeXT not tested. I will play in next couple of
weeks.
13. XeTeX not tested!
14. detex tested.
